      In the United States, concerns about algorithmic bias, data privacy, and digital literacy have sparked a national conversation. As social media platforms, search engines, and online services become increasingly influential, people are demanding more insight into the decision-making processes behind these tools. Governments, regulatory bodies, and industry leaders are also taking notice, leading to a surge in research, advocacy, and policy discussions.
